What Are Compact Cube Cases?
Compact cube cases are small, cube-shaped enclosures designed to maximize space efficiency. They typically support standard ATX, Micro-ATX, or Mini-ITX motherboards and are ideal for users seeking powerful yet space-saving setups. Their compact form factor makes them suitable for desks with limited space or for those who prefer a minimalist aesthetic.
The Role of PSU Shrouds in Modern Cases
Power Supply Unit (PSU) shrouds are covers that conceal the PSU and associated cables. They contribute to a cleaner interior, reduce cable clutter, and improve airflow. In 2026, most high-end compact cube cases incorporate PSU shrouds as standard features, reflecting a focus on aesthetics and thermal efficiency.

Building Tips for 2026
When assembling a PC in a compact cube case with a PSU shroud, consider the following:
- Plan Cable Routing: Use the shroud to hide excess cables for a clean look.
- Choose Compatible Components: Ensure your GPU and cooling solutions fit within the case dimensions.
- Optimize Airflow: Position fans strategically to promote good airflow through the case.
- Use Modular Power Supplies: Modular PSUs help reduce cable clutter.
